Pin code 331402 belongs to Churu district in Rajasthan, India. This pin code is served by 7 post offices, with Derajsar (Branch Office) as the primary office. It falls under the Jodhpur postal region, Churu division, and Rajasthan postal circle. The taluk covered is Sardarshahar.

What Does Pin Code 331402 Mean?

Every Indian PIN code is a 6-digit number where each digit carries a specific meaning. Here's how 331402 breaks down:

Digit Position Value What It Represents
1st digit — Postal Zone 3 Western region of India
2nd digit — Sub-zone 3 Sub-region within Rajasthan
3rd digit — Sorting District 1 Churu sorting district
Last 3 digits — Post Office 402 Derajsar (B.O)

The first digit 3 places this pincode in the Western postal zone. The combination 33 narrows it to a sub-region within Rajasthan, while 331 identifies the Churu sorting district. The final three digits 402 point to the specific delivery post office — Derajsar.
